Title: Beethoven's 2nd
Tagline: The Newton Family is going to the dogs...
Genre: Family,Comedy
Director: Rod Daniel
Cast: Charles Grodin,Bonnie Hunt,Nicholle Tom,Christopher Castile,Sarah Rose Karr,Debi Mazar,Chris Penn,Ashley Hamilton,Danny Masterson,Catherine Reitman,Maury Chaykin,Heather McComb,Scott Waara,Jeff Corey,Virginia Capers,Devon Gummersall,Jason Perkins,Jordan Bond,Robert Cavanaugh,Randall Slavin,Dion Zamora,Damien Rapp,Todd Kolker,Adena Bjork,Pat Jankiewicz,Tom Dugan,Holly Wortell,Don Lake,Chris,Kevin Dunn,William Schallert
Status: Released
Release: 1993-12-14
Runtime: 89
Plot: Beethoven is back -- and this time, he has a whole brood with him now that he's met his canine match, Missy, and fathered a family. The only problem is that Missy's owner, Regina, wants to sell the puppies and tear the clan apart.
